A hospital management system built from scratch has to handle patient records, appointment scheduling, billing, staff rosters, and inventory as one connected system rather than five disconnected tools glued together with spreadsheets. We build the backend in Laravel because its migration system and role-based permissions make it straightforward to model the messy reality of a clinic: different access levels for front desk, nurses, physicians, and billing staff, all touching the same patient record without stepping on each other. React handles the admin and clinical dashboards, since a scheduler juggling three exam rooms and a walk-in queue needs a fast, responsive interface, not a page reload every time they update a slot.

MySQL stores the structured data (patient records, billing codes, appointment history) with the referential integrity that a REST API layer exposes to whatever front end needs it, whether that is the web dashboard, a partner lab's system, or a mobile app. For clinics that want patients or field staff to check schedules or intake forms from a phone, we build that piece in Flutter so one codebase covers iOS and Android instead of paying twice for two native apps.

For a practice near Bondsville managing patients across a few towns in Hampden County, that mobile piece matters more than it would in a single-building hospital. A visiting nurse or physical therapist working out of a car between appointments needs to pull up a chart offline and sync it later, not lose connectivity and lose the visit notes. Firebase handles push notifications for appointment reminders and staff shift alerts, and Stripe handles patient payments and insurance co-pay collection without you building a PCI-compliant payment flow from zero.

We do not recommend building everything from scratch every time. If a practice's real need is basic e-prescribing or lab integration with a major regional health network, sometimes the honest answer is to buy that piece and custom-build only the workflow layer around it. We will tell you when that is the case instead of pitching a bigger build than you need.

We build access controls, audit logs, and encrypted storage into the system architecture from the start rather than adding them later. You and your compliance counsel remain responsible for your HIPAA program and any required business associate agreements; we build the technical controls that program requires. This is a conversation we have early in scoping, not after the system is built.

Off-the-shelf hospital platforms often charge per-user licensing fees that scale poorly for a small or mid-size practice, and they force your workflow to match their template. Laravel and React let us build exactly the screens and permission model your staff needs, and MySQL keeps the underlying data structure something your team can query and report on directly. You also own the code outright, which you do not get with most licensed platforms.
